Ice Not Coming Out of Ice Maker

Why Isn’t Ice Coming Out of Ice Maker?

An ice maker that won’t dispense ice can be frustrating, especially when you need a cold drink. This issue can arise from blockages, mechanical malfunctions, or power disruptions. Prompt troubleshooting is key to restoring the convenience of your ice maker.

Common Reasons an Ice Maker Stops Producing Ice

  • Jammed Ice Dispenser: Ice can clump together or get stuck in the chute, preventing new ice from dispensing properly.
  • Faulty Dispenser Motor: The motor drives the mechanism that pushes the ice out. If the motor fails, the dispenser won’t work.
  • Blocked or Frozen Auger: The auger moves ice through the dispenser. If it’s frozen or obstructed, ice can’t be pushed out.
  • Malfunctioning Dispenser Switch: The switch activates the ice dispensing mechanism. A defective switch may stop the system from responding to your commands.
  • Improper Freezer Temperature: If the freezer is too warm, ice may partially melt and refreeze, causing clogs and dispensing issues.
